Françoise Rogalewicz is a scholar working on Spectroscopy, Analytical Chemistry and Molecular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, Françoise Rogalewicz has authored 12 papers receiving a total of 559 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 11 papers in Spectroscopy, 5 papers in Analytical Chemistry and 2 papers in Molecular Biology. Recurrent topics in Françoise Rogalewicz’s work include Mass Spectrometry Techniques and Applications (11 papers), Analytical Chemistry and Chromatography (9 papers) and Analytical chemistry methods development (5 papers). Françoise Rogalewicz is often cited by papers focused on Mass Spectrometry Techniques and Applications (11 papers), Analytical Chemistry and Chromatography (9 papers) and Analytical chemistry methods development (5 papers). Françoise Rogalewicz collaborates with scholars based in France. Françoise Rogalewicz's co-authors include Gilles Ohanessian, Yannik Hoppilliard, Nohad Gresh, Sophie Hoyau, Sophie Bourcier, Stéphane Bouchonnet, Pascal Richomme, Eric Levillain, Stéphane Pirnay and Fabrice Odobel and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Chromatography A, Journal of Computational Chemistry and Rapid Communications in Mass Spectrometry.
